Content SEO

Header Tag Hierarchy

Việc sử dụng đúng thứ tự và cấu trúc thẻ tiêu đề (H1 → H2 → H3…) để phản ánh cấu trúc logic và mức độ quan trọng của nội dung.

4 lượt xem Cập nhật: 27/05/2026

Header Tag Hierarchy là gì?

Header Tag Hierarchy (cấu trúc phân cấp thẻ tiêu đề) là cách sắp xếp các thẻ HTML <h1> đến <h6> theo thứ tự logic, phản ánh mức độ quan trọng và mối quan hệ phân nhánh của nội dung trên trang. Đây không phải là danh sách ngẫu nhiên, mà là một cây cấu trúc — trong đó <h1> là gốc, các <h2> là nhánh chính, <h3> là tiểu mục của <h2>, và cứ thế tiếp tục.

Thứ tự bắt buộc là tuyến tính và không được nhảy cấp: không được dùng <h3> trước khi có <h2>; không được bỏ qua <h2> để chuyển thẳng từ <h1> sang <h4>. Trình duyệt và công cụ tìm kiếm (như Google) dựa vào cấu trúc này để hiểu bố cục và ngữ nghĩa nội dung — giống như mục lục sách giúp người đọc nắm nhanh toàn cảnh.

Tại sao quan trọng trong SEO?

Cấu trúc tiêu đề đúng giúp cả người và máy hiểu rõ nội dung:

  • Với người dùng: Tăng khả năng quét nhanh (scannability), cải thiện trải nghiệm đọc, hỗ trợ người dùng khuyết tật (screen reader đọc theo thứ bậc)
  • Với công cụ tìm kiếm: Là tín hiệu mạnh về chủ đề, trọng tâm và tổ chức nội dung — đặc biệt khi kết hợp với từ khóa, vị trí và mật độ tự nhiên
  • Với SEO kỹ thuật: Hỗ trợ lập chỉ mục chính xác hơn, giảm nhiễu ngữ nghĩa, tăng khả năng xuất hiện trong rich snippet (ví dụ: đoạn trích có đánh dấu cấu trúc)

Google khẳng định rõ ràng rằng họ sử dụng thẻ tiêu đề để hiểu cấu trúc nội dung (theo tài liệu chính thức Google Search Central). Tuy nhiên, không có bằng chứng nào cho thấy việc dùng nhiều <h1> hay nhảy cấp trực tiếp làm trang bị phạt — nhưng điều đó làm suy yếu tín hiệu ngữ nghĩa, dẫn đến hiểu sai chủ đề hoặc giảm độ tin cậy của trang.

Cách hoạt động

Các công cụ tìm kiếm phân tích header tag hierarchy như một cây cú pháp ngữ nghĩa. Mỗi thẻ <hX> được xem là một nút trong cây, với mức độ ưu tiên giảm dần từ <h1> (cao nhất) đến <h6> (thấp nhất). Trình thu thập dữ liệu (crawler) không chỉ đọc nội dung bên trong thẻ, mà còn ghi nhận:

  • Mối quan hệ cha – con giữa các cấp (ví dụ: tất cả <h3> dưới một <h2> được coi là thuộc cùng một chủ đề phụ)
  • Khoảng cách vị trí giữa các thẻ cùng cấp (gần nhau → liên quan cao hơn)
  • Sự nhất quán trong mô hình (ví dụ: nếu trang có 5 <h2>, thì mỗi <h2> nên có ít nhất một <h3> đi kèm — tùy trường hợp)

Không có giới hạn cứng về số lượng thẻ mỗi cấp, nhưng thực tế cho thấy trang tối ưu thường có 1 <h1>, 2–6 <h2>, và mỗi <h2> có 0–4 <h3>.

Hướng dẫn thực hiện

  1. Xác định chủ đề chính: Viết duy nhất một <h1> ngắn gọn, chứa từ khóa chính, đặt ở đầu phần nội dung (không phải đầu trang HTML hay trong header chung)
  2. Chia thành các phần lớn: Dùng <h2> cho từng khối nội dung độc lập (ví dụ: Giới thiệu, Cách làm, Ưu điểm, Nhược điểm, Kết luận)
  3. Phân nhánh sâu hơn: Dưới mỗi <h2>, dùng <h3> cho các ý nhỏ hơn (ví dụ: dưới “Cách làm” → “Chuẩn bị nguyên liệu”, “Bước 1”, “Bước 2”)
  4. Duy trì thứ tự tuần tự: Không bao giờ dùng <h3> nếu chưa có <h2> đứng trước nó trong cùng phạm vi nội dung
  5. Kiểm tra bằng công cụ: Dùng trình kiểm tra cấu trúc (như SEO Minion, Web Developer Toolbar, hoặc Lighthouse trong Chrome DevTools) để xác minh thứ bậc và phát hiện lỗi

Lỗi thường gặp

Lỗi Hệ quả Cách khắc phục
Dùng nhiều <h1> trên cùng một trang Làm loãng trọng tâm, gây khó khăn cho crawler xác định chủ đề chính Giữ đúng 1 <h1> — thường nằm trong thẻ <main>, không trong <header> chung của site
Nhảy cấp (ví dụ: <h1><h3>) Mất liên kết ngữ nghĩa, giảm độ tin cậy của cấu trúc Thêm <h2> trung gian hoặc điều chỉnh lại cấp độ cho phù hợp
Dùng thẻ tiêu đề chỉ để định dạng (font to / đậm) Không tạo tín hiệu SEO, gây nhiễu phân tích Thay bằng <span> + CSS hoặc dùng đúng thẻ <hX> có ngữ nghĩa

Ví dụ thực tế

Dưới đây là cấu trúc tiêu đề đúng cho bài viết hướng dẫn “Cách trồng rau muống tại nhà”:

<h1>Cách trồng rau muống tại nhà hiệu quả trong 7 ngày</h1>
<h2>Tại sao nên trồng rau muống?</h2>
<h3>Giá trị dinh dưỡng</h3>
<h3>Chi phí thấp, dễ chăm sóc</h3>
<h2>Chuẩn bị trước khi trồng</h2>
<h3>Chọn hạt giống chất lượng</h3>
<h3>Dụng cụ cần thiết</h3>
<h2>Các bước trồng chi tiết</h2>
<h3>Bước 1: Ngâm hạt</h3>
<h3>Bước 2: Gieo hạt vào đất</h3>
<h3>Bước 3: Chăm sóc hàng ngày</h3>
<h2>Thu hoạch và bảo quản</h2>

Cấu trúc này rõ ràng, tuyến tính, dễ mở rộng và hoàn toàn tuân thủ chuẩn WCAG cũng như khuyến nghị của Google.

Câu hỏi thường gặp

Có thể dùng nhiều <h1> trên một trang không?

Theo tiêu chuẩn HTML5, việc dùng nhiều <h1> là hợp lệ nếu mỗi cái nằm trong một section độc lập (ví dụ: trong <article> riêng). Tuy nhiên, trong thực tế SEO, gần như luôn nên giữ đúng 1 <h1> cho toàn bộ trang — vì đây vẫn là tín hiệu mạnh nhất về chủ đề chính. Việc dùng nhiều <h1> chỉ nên áp dụng trong các trang tổng hợp (tạp chí, blog list) và phải được kiểm soát chặt chẽ.

Thẻ <h4>, <h5>, <h6> có cần thiết không?

Không bắt buộc, nhưng rất hữu ích khi nội dung có độ sâu cao (ví dụ: tài liệu kỹ thuật, giáo trình, hướng dẫn chuyên sâu). Nếu dùng, phải đảm bảo chúng xuất hiện đúng sau <h3> và trong cùng phạm vi. Nhiều trang không cần đến <h5> hay <h6> — điều này hoàn toàn bình thường.

Header hierarchy ảnh hưởng đến thứ hạng trực tiếp không?

Không có bằng chứng nào cho thấy Google dùng cấu trúc tiêu đề như một yếu tố xếp hạng độc lập. Tuy nhiên, nó ảnh hưởng gián tiếp rất mạnh: qua cải thiện trải nghiệm người dùng, tăng thời gian ở lại trang, giảm tỷ lệ thoát và hỗ trợ lập chỉ mục chính xác — những yếu tố đều nằm trong hệ sinh thái xếp hạng hiện đại. Vì vậy, đây là yêu cầu nền tảng, không phải “tùy chọn”.